Home secretary described Stockton-on-Tees as ‘shit-hole’, MP claims

Alex Cunningham, MP for Stockton North, claims James Cleverly made comment during Wednesday’s PMQs

A Labour MP has claimed that his constituency was described as a “shit-hole” by the home secretary, James Cleverly, during prime minister’s questions.
Alex Cunningham said Cleverly had uttered the phrase when the Labour MP for Stockton North asked: “Why are 34% of children in my constituency living in poverty?”
After standing up later in parliament to raise a point of order with the deputy speaker Eleanor Laing, Cunningham said of Cleverly: “He was seen and heard to say, ‘Because it’s a shit-hole’,” Cunningham said, to gasps from fellow Labour MPs.
